For trypanosoma brucei gambiense 2nd stage: clear for the
eflornithine/nifurtimox (i guess no news about an oral eflornithine
formulation?) but what about then the rhodesiense form for which there is
still only the ancient melarsoprol ('arsenic in antifreeze') to which
despite its toxicity in addition the parasite has managed to develop
resistance due to uncontrolled wide spread use of trypanocidals in cattle, i suggest to develop a EMLa to define an essential list for treatment of animal reservoirs...

section 19.2 tuberculine diagnostic (PPD): an asterisk (*) could be added to mention that tuberculine readings may be difficult in immunocompromised
persons and must take into account the patients history, medical condition,
symptoms, X-ray findings and previous history of BCG.
